Sir Henry Morton Stanley (also known as Bula Matari, "Breaker of Rocks" in Congo), born John Rowlands (1841-1904), was a 19th-century, Welsh-born, American journalist and explorer famous for his exploration of Africa and his search for David Livingstone.
